Court of Appeals of New York


CHAMBERS v. OLD STONE HILL RD. ASSOCS., 15

Restrictive covenants intended to preserve the residential character of defendant's neighborhood prevent it from leasing a lot for purposes of siting a wireless telecommunications tower. The town's determination that this site provides the least intrusive means to close a significant gap in personal wireless services does not justify extinguishing the covenants.
